THE Board

1. Who are you and what do you do for living ?

2. What do you do in the Board and why did

you join?

3. What would you want for the game in the

nearest future?

4. What next bigger step would be good for the

game?

Andres Soto, joined from the Kickstater Campaign, as first member

1. Andrés Emilio Soto, licensed real estate

salesperson in New York City. I'm also the owner, founder and host of NYCFC Fan Podcast, which supports New York City's only MLS team.

2. I bring a much needed New York flair to the

game and in all sincerity want to help take this game to the next level, every single tick. I chose to join so I can have a vote in the direction the game moves.

3. What I want for the game in the near future is

the possibility to open the game to thousands of new users with different game worlds in a sustainable technological support system.

4. The next biggest step for the game is

obtaining a way to monetize from advertising without losing stability and game quality.

Thiago Netz, elected as managers' representative, fourth member

1. I'm a Brazilian, graduated in business

management and currently working for Rio

2016 Olympic Committee in a totally different area.

2. I was given the chance by the original

members of the Initiative Board to represent part of the community. I do consider to be a representative of the "old game", since I've been around for a while, even if relatively unknown to most back then.

3. I'd like a stable game with many of its bugs

fixed and some new interface solutions. An

amalgam of the amazing game with the new possibilities technology now gives us.

4. Probably an increase on the players' "voice"

in transfers. If not sold, he would complain. or board intervene. Maybe some other formula, but market must be more dynamic. And the community too.
